Output 626aead04b9a96499ab3fab9176b90665992ebf4297bed2d130a53b0f154a1e4:4

value
622160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3921ff392639ed480de36a58f3df2b023f01e2 OP_EQUAL
address
3Bq7NVaRoDkj9BV2Gh2hBGjghFDjvQSxN6
transaction
626aead04b9a96499ab3fab9176b90665992ebf4297bed2d130a53b0f154a1e4
spent
true